Does solar power generation use thermal energy

Does solar power generation use thermal energy

Instead of converting sunlight directly into electricity, as photovoltaics does, solar thermal harnesses the sun's energy to heat a fluid called a heat carrier and then uses that heat to generate electricity or provide heat for industrial or domestic applications.

Harm of rural solar photovoltaic power generation

Harm of rural solar photovoltaic power generation

Some analyses indicate that up to 83% of new solar development is planned for agricultural and ranchland. The conversion of land can disrupt natural processes. Clearing and grading during construction can cause soil erosion and increase sediment runoff into waterways.
